The Anatomy of a Versatile Ski Boot

The crux of an all-mountain ski boot lies in its masterful balance of performance and comfort. Understanding its intricate components is paramount:

Flex Rating:
This numerical value quantifies the boot’s stiffness. A higher flex rating indicates a stiffer boot, providing greater responsiveness and precision for advanced skiers. Lower flex ratings offer enhanced comfort and forgiveness, making them ideal for beginners and intermediates.

Last Width:
The last width determines the internal width of the boot shell. A narrower last provides a snugger fit, enhancing control and reducing fatigue. A wider last accommodates feet with higher volume, ensuring comfort for extended periods.

Cuff Height:
The height of the boot cuff influences its level of support. A taller cuff offers greater ankle stability, while a shorter cuff promotes agility and maneuverability, particularly in deep snow or moguls.

Liner:
The liner, akin to the shoe’s insole, plays a pivotal role in comfort and performance. Thermoformable liners can be customized to mold to the shape of your foot, providing a precise and supportive fit. Removable liners allow for easy drying and cleaning.

Buckles and Straps:
The number and placement of buckles and straps determine the boot’s closure system. A combination of buckles and straps offers a secure and customizable fit, accommodating varying calf sizes and preferences.

How Thermal Molding Works

Thermal molding involves heating the liner in a specialized oven or using a heat gun. Once the liner is soft and pliable, it is placed on your foot and a vacuum is applied to draw the liner into contact with every contour of your foot. The liner is then cooled to set the shape.

The Importance of Shell Construction: Understanding Plastic and Carbon Fiber

The outer shell of a ski boot plays a crucial role in providing support, flex, and comfort. It’s typically made of either plastic or carbon fiber, each with its unique properties.

Plastic Shells

Plastic shells, typically composed of polyurethane (PU) or Pebax, are widely used in ski boots due to their affordability, durability, and flexibility. They offer a balance of comfort and support, adapting to the shape of your feet over time. However, plastic shells can be heavier and less responsive than carbon fiber shells.

Carbon Fiber Shells

Carbon fiber shells are renowned for their exceptional stiffness and lightweight. They provide precise edge control and enhanced responsiveness, making them ideal for aggressive skiers and racers. However, carbon fiber shells can be more expensive and less forgiving than plastic shells.

Choosing the Right Flooring for Your Garage Gym

When it comes to garage gyms, the flooring you choose plays a crucial role in durability, safety, and overall functionality. Here’s a comprehensive guide to help you make the best decision:

1. Rubber Flooring:

  • Durable and impact-resistant, making it ideal for heavy lifting and cardio.
  • Provides excellent cushioning, reducing noise and vibrations.
  • Resistant to moisture, making it low-maintenance.

2. Vinyl Flooring:

  • Affordable and easy to install.
  • Water-resistant and stain-resistant, making it easy to clean.
  • Less durable than rubber flooring, not suitable for heavy-duty use.

3. Carpet Flooring:

  • Provides a comfortable and non-slip surface.
  • Reduces noise and vibrations.
  • Prone to dirt, moisture, and damage, requiring regular maintenance.

4. Epoxy Flooring:

  • Durable and resistant to wear and tear.
  • Creates a seamless and smooth surface.
  • More expensive than other flooring options.

5. Plywood Flooring:

  • Relatively affordable and easy to install.
  • Provides a stable and level surface.
  • Susceptible to moisture and damage.

6. Grass Mats:

  • Versatile and can be used for both indoor and outdoor gyms.
  • Provide drainage and prevent moisture buildup.
  • Not suitable for heavy equipment or high-impact workouts.
